instantiationexception

发布时间:2023-05-12 02:28:21 栏目:科技

    导读 大家好,小豆来为大家解答以上的问题。instantiationexception这个很多人还不知道,现在让我们一起来看看吧!1、[Java] view plain copyst

    大家好,小豆来为大家解答以上的问题。instantiationexception这个很多人还不知道,现在让我们一起来看看吧!

    1、[Java] view plain copystatic Object createNewInstance(Object obj){ try { return obj.getClass().newInstance(); } catch (InstantiationException e) { e.printStackTrace(); } catch (IllegalAccessException e) { e.printStackTrace(); } return null; } public static void main(String[] args) { String[] s = new String[]{"a","b","c"}; createNewInstance(s); } 运行main方法的时候,抛出InstantiationException 异常,因为我用了数组去调用Class的newInstance()方法接口。

    2、(abstract)抽象类,数组类和(primitive)基本类型,或者void的类型,或者没有无参构造器的类。

    3、调用getClass().newInstance()都会这个异常.。

    本文到此分享完毕,希望对大家有所帮助。

免责声明:本文由用户上传,如有侵权请联系删除!